Laser diodes represent a key element in the emerging field of opto electronics which includes, for example, optical communication, optical sensors or optical disc systems. For all these applications, information is either transmitted, stored or read out. The performance of these systems depends to a great deal on the performance of the laser diode with regard to its modulation and noise characteristics. Since the modulation and noise characteristics of laser diodes are of vital importance for optoelectronic systems, the need for a book arises that concentrates on this subject. This book thus closes the gap between books on the device physics of semiconductor lasers and books on system design. Complementary to the specific topics concerning modulation and noise, the first part of this book reviews the basic laser characteristics, so that even a reader without detailed knowledge of laser diodes may follow the text. In order to understand the book, the reader should have a basic knowledge of electronics, semiconductor physics and optical communica tions. The work is primarily written for the engineer or scientist working in the field of optoelectronics; however, since the book is self-contained and since it contains a lot of numerical examples, it may serve as a textbook for graduate students. In the field of laser diode modulation and noise a vast amount has been published during recent years. Even though the book contains more than 600 references, only a small part of the existing literature is included.

The original edition of Klaus Grawe's book exploring the basis and need for a more generally valid concept of psychotherapy fueled a lively debate among psychotherapists and psychologists in German-speaking areas. Now available in English, this book will help spread the concepts and the debate among a wider audience. The book is written in dialog form. A practicing therapist, a research psychologist, and a therapy researcher take part in three dialogs, each of which builds on the results of the previous dialog. The first dialog explores how therapeutic change takes place, while the second looks at how the mechanisms of action of psychotherapy can be understood in terms of basic psychological concepts. Finally, in the third dialog, a psychological theory of psychotherapy is developed. The practical implications of this are clearly shown in the form of case examples, as well as guidance on indications and treatment planning. The dialog ends with suggestions as to how therapy training and provision of psychotherapy could be improved on the basis of the model of psychotherapy that has been developed.
The intimate relationship between global European expansion since the early modern period and the concurrent beginnings of the scientific revolution has long been acknowledged. The contributions in this volume approach the entanglement of science and cultural encounters - many of them in colonial settings - from a variety of perspectives. Historical and historiographical survey essays sketch a transcultural history of knowledge and conduct a critical dialogue between the recent academic fields of Postcolonial Studies and Science & Empire Studies; a series of case studies explores the topos of Europe's 'great inventions', the scientific exploitation of culturally unfamiliar people and objects, the representation of indigenous cultures in discourses of geographical exploration, as well as non-European scientific practices. 'Entangled Knowledges' also refers to the critical practices of scholarship: various essays investigate scholarship's own failures in self-reflexivity, arising from an uncritical appropriation of cultural stereotypes and colonial myths, of which the discourse of Orientalism in historiography and residual racialist assumptions in modern genetics serve as examples. The volume thus contributes to the study of cultural and colonial relations as well as to the history of science and scholarship.

Very Short Introductions: Brilliant, Sharp, Inspiring The Arctic is demanding global attention. It is warming, melting, and thawing in a manner that threatens fundamental state-change. For communities that call the Arctic 'home' this is unwelcome. A warming Arctic brings with it the spectre of costly disruption and interference in indigenous lives and communal welfare. For others, the disappearance of sea ice makes the Arctic appear more accessible and less remote. This also brings with it dangers such as the prospect of a new era of great power rivalries involving China, Russia, and the United States. Submarine and long-range bomber patrolling are now commonplace. New terms such as 'global Arctic' are being used to capture the dynamic of change while others muse about the 'return of a Cold War'. The reality is inevitably more complex. The physical geography of the Arctic is highly varied and variable. Environmental change brings opportunities for indigenous and non-indigenous life-forms to survive and even thrive. The Arctic's four million people are not helpless pawns in a game of global geopolitics. The Arctic is not only a resource hotspot but also a place where sustainable energy systems are being introduced. A warming Arctic with less ice and permafrost is not unique in the longer history of the Earth either. The Arctic is a complex space. In this Very Short Introduction, Klaus Dodds and Jamie Woodward consider the major dimensions of the region and the linkages beyond - from the geopolitical to the environmental. They examine the causes, drivers, and effects of cultural, physical, political, and economic change, and ponder the future of the Arctic. As they show, it is a future which will affect us all. This book provides an overview of investigations into the interrela tions between stressful living conditions, individual coping strategies, and social support networks, on the one hand, and physiological, psychological, and social "health", on the other. Health is used as a broad term, and is defined as a state of physical and mental well being by which an individual is capable of processing inner and outer reality in a productive and satisfying manner. The potential stresses and strains inherent in the lifestyles of children, adolescents, and adults in contemporary industrial societies are the prime concern of this book. I try to offer a comprehensive view which takes modern socialization theory as its starting point. Chapter 1 introduces the subject and discusses the psychological and social "costs" that accompany life within modern industrial soci ety. Chapter 2 reviews research on types and distribution of social, psychological, and somatic disorders. Chapter 3 explores the risk fac tors and constellations of stressful life events, role conflicts, and tran sitions and focuses on the changes in types of demand or strains throughout the life span. Chapter 4 contains an analysis of the per sonal and social "resources" that can be mobilized if stress occurs.
Optical Fiber Current and Voltage Sensors is the first book to provide a complete, comprehensive and up to date treatment of the domain of fiber optic and polarimetric sensors, covering fundamental operating principles, characteristics, and construction. Written by one of the most recognised experts in polarimetric sensing, Optical Fiber Current and Voltage Sensors begins by covering the fundamentals of polarized light, as well as essential sensor components. The author then goes on to outline various sensor types and their applications, with a focus on sensors for electric phenomena. The chapters then lay out the demands that sensors need to meet, the technical obstacles and limitations which need to be considered. The book also covers comparisons to corresponding traditional instruments, as well as covering alternative non-conventional sensors. This volume presents the proceedings of the Fourth International Workshop on Analogical and Inductive Inference (AII '94) and the Fifth International Workshop on Algorithmic Learning Theory (ALT '94), held jointly at Reinhardsbrunn Castle, Germany in October 1994. (In future the AII and ALT workshops will be amalgamated and held under the single title of Algorithmic Learning Theory.) The book contains revised versions of 45 papers on all current aspects of computational learning theory; in particular, algorithmic learning, machine learning, analogical inference, inductive logic, case-based reasoning, and formal language learning are addressed.
Ever since the boom of spectrum analysis in the 1860s, spectroscopy has become one of the most fruitful research technologies in analytic chemistry, physics, astronomy, and other sciences. This book is the first in-depth study of the ways in which various types of spectra, especially the sun's Fraunhofer lines, have been recorded, displayed, and interpreted. The book assesses the virtues and pitfalls of various types of depictions, including hand sketches, woodcuts, engravings, lithographs and, from the late 1870s onwards, photomechanical reproductions. The material of a 19th-century engraver or lithographer, the daily research practice of a spectroscopist in the laboratory, or a student's use of spectrum posters in the classroom, all are looked at and documented here. For pioneers of photography such as John Herschel or Hermann Wilhelm Vogel, the spectrum even served as a prime test object for gauging the color sensitivity of their processes. This is a broad, contextual portrayal of the visual culture of spectroscopy in the 19th and early 20th centuries. The illustrations are not confined to spectra--they show instruments, laboratories, people at work, and plates of printing manuals. The result is a multifacetted description, focusing on the period from Fraunhofer up to the beginning of Bohr's quantum theory. A great deal of new and fascinating material from two dozen archives has been included. Following his seminal book Wood and Wood Joints, an essential reference on solid timber constructions for more than two decades, now in its third edition, Klaus Zwerger presents a study of the cultural history, construction and typology of a special building type: cereal drying racks. These structures were used to dry harvested crops in agrarian cultures all over the world and evolved over the centuries into buildings of great beauty that are as sophisticated and individual as they are functionally efficient. On countless expeditions, the author tracked down the remaining buildings, documenting and analyzing them in the context of their cultural and building history through detailed descriptions, line drawings and photographs, rendered in duotone, by the author.
